## CI Note — InvoiceForge PDF Renderer

Renderer jobs failing on the Quillbank runner: font subsetting step times out when invoices exceed 40 pages. Workaround: rerun with the cached font bundle enabled. Do not escalate to the platform team unless two consecutive retries fail. Support: tell customers affected invoices regenerate overnight. Fix is merged but not yet deployed; watch the Tuesday release train. When filing a follow-up, reference the failing pipeline by the token shown below.

pipeline stamp: htk9_ce63042d9

Subject: Key rotation — Lattice component library registry

Per the quarterly rotation schedule, the publish key for the Lattice shared component registry has been rotated. Versioning policy is unchanged: semver-strict, no force-publishes. Old key is revoked as of today. CI secrets in Relaybuild have been updated. For your audit trail, the new key is below.

service key, yadug-bajog: zpat3_pou

Reseller Programme — Branch Manager Notes (Restricted)

Quick update on the Wrenfield Partner Scheme. We're at 27 active resellers, and the new onboarding flow has cut setup time to under two weeks — nice work, everyone. Watch the discount stacking issue: a few branches are layering promo codes on partner pricing, which kills margin. Flag anything above 18% to your regional lead. There's a change coming to partner tiers next quarter, and the confidential summary is just below.

confidential, kagup-bafog: Fraaxax Group is in early talks to buy Soroxox Group for about $343.8 million. The Olidor launch date is June 14, and nothing goes to the press before then. Legal wants the Aldmirek Logistics term sheet signed before July 23.

## Formula sandbox tuning

User-supplied formulas in Gridmoor execute inside a restricted interpreter with hard ceilings on time, memory, and call depth. Reviewers should confirm any change to these ceilings is justified in the PR description, since raising them widens the abuse surface. Defaults were chosen from production traces. The current limits are as follows.

limits module of tafog-fawip:
WEIGHTS = {
    "julix": 57,
    "lamys": 992,
    "kasvan": 209,
    "quenok": 750,
    "alddor": 259,
    "oliath": 1009,
    "wenix": 815,
}